Prime Music just changed from am on demand model to shuffle. You now have the full catalogue, but you can't really pick anything. Thoughts? Personally, I hate it and am thinking of dropping Prime altogether because this reduces the value (to me) while they're bumping up prices (and getting rid of Treasure Truck). I can get free shipping on a huge selection with Walmart+ and pay for Spotify for only a bit more than what Amazon wants for basic Prime now.

Last week. It doesn't affect Prime Music Unlimited if you have that, but it's an extra $9/mth. Also, if you've purchased music, it should not be affected, though Amazon's rollout screwed up many people's accounts and forced their purchased music into shuffle only playlists.
